Job DescriptionLocate Technicians are responsible for accurately locating underground facilities such as telephone, electric, cable television, gas, fiber optic, water, and sewer lines. They observe, locate, mark, and document underground and exposed utility locations to ensure compliance with client and state requirements. The position requires independent work or teamwork, dedicated focus, skill, and machinery/tool proficiency.
Responsibilities- Locate underground facilities using transmitters and surface equipment.
- Work across various terrains, construction zones, residential, commercial, industrial, and rural areas in all weather conditions.
- Interpret job order tickets, blueprints, and maps to route and perform duties efficiently.
- Perform locates and emergency/on‑call locates during regular, overtime, and holiday hours as necessary.
- Maintain timely, professional work while communicating effectively with customers, co‑employees, and third parties.
- Ensure a damage‑free environment by communicating with management, contractors, and utility customers.
- Use necessary technology and tools for accurate locating.
- Work under supervisor guidance in a supervised team environment.
